CULTURE NEWS
- ➤ Bethlehem is hosting its 21st annual Southside Film Festival featuring 80 indie films from around the world — with international entries from Cyprus, Ireland, Estonia, and Qatar and a local documentary, Rooted, scheduled for June 15 — at venues including Zoellner Arts Center and the Cathedral Church of the Nativity. WFMZ
- ➤ The award-winning musical 'The Producers' will run at the Pennsylvania Shakespeare Festival on the DeSales campus (in Lehigh Valley) with previews today and Thursday, opening night Friday, and performances continuing until June 29 at the Labuda Center for the Performing Arts. The production holds the record for most Tony Awards won by a single show and brings Broadway-caliber entertainment to the area. Lehigh Valley Live
- ➤ Alice Cooper, known for hits such as 'School’s Out,' will perform at Wind Creek Event Center in Bethlehem at 8 p.m. on Aug. 16. Tickets—priced between $59.50 and $129.50—will go on sale to the public at 10 a.m. on June 13. WLVR
ECONOMY NEWS
- ➤ Don Cunningham, president and CEO of the Lehigh Valley Economic Development Corporation, was named to the Trailblazers in Economic and Workforce Development list by City and State Pennsylvania on June 10—his award came as the region saw record economic output, over 340,000 jobs, and a median household income above $81,000, with other local leaders also being honored. Lehigh Valley Economic Development
- ➤ LVEDC hosted state legislators and federal officials on June 5 at Melt in Center Valley to review strong economic figures and discuss strategies for growing the region’s output—highlighting rising GDP, job increases, and new manufacturing projects that are expected to create hundreds of jobs. The agency also outlined its strategic plan for 2025-2027 to boost talent development and streamline economic policies moving forward. Lehigh Valley Economic Development
